pasted it to Word first. Just wanted to say that it was fairly easy and the only new
documents we gave were our tax forms & W-2s since we applied for AOS 2 years ago;
bills, bank statements, and apt rental agreement with both of our names; his Advance
Parole docs and latest I-94; photos from our wedding; employment letters.

We brought birth certificate originals and copies but since they had been submitted
with the AOS application, we didn't have to give those documents again. We did not
need a medical exam either, presumably because it was done for the K-1 visa.

The interview started about an hour and a half after the scheduled time, but in
itself only took 15-20 minutes. It was in the Immigration Officer's office; no sign
of the Interview being videotaped.
